
No fewer than 40 people, including five soldiers and a local hunter, were reported to have been killed following a bomb explosion on Thursday morning around Mararaba-Mubi area of Adamawa State.
Eyewitness told newsmen in Yola, the state capital, that a combined team of the military and local hunters patrolling the area after they had successful recaptured Mubi from the insurgents were mostly affected.
It was learnt that the bomb planted by the insurgents exploded and killed the 40 people instantly.
According to the eyewitness, the scene of the blast was a busy area where people returning to the town after the recaptured of Mubi gathered to do one business or the other.
